197. To ask the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port the number of motorcycle driving tests that were applied for in 2020 and 2021, respectively; the number of motorcycle driving tests that were undertaken in 2020 and 2021, respectively; the number of outstanding motorcycle driving tests currently; his plans to remove the backlog in motorcycle driving tests;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[10930/22]

Photo of Hildegarde NaughtonHildegarde Naughton (Galway West,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

Under legislation, the Road Safety Authority is responsible for the operation of the motorcycle test and the information requested is held by them. I have therefore forwarded the Deputy's query to the RSA for direct reply. I would ask the Deputy to contact my office if a response has not been received within ten days.
